如何使用W5100S-EVB-Pico连接Azure物联网中心
使用Wiznet的W5100S-EVB-Pico板以及X.509證書連接到Azure物聯網中心
注:最初發表-by renakim
組成:
硬件設施:
W5100S-EVB-Pico ×1
W5100S-EVB-Pico | WIZnet Document System
軟件應用程序和在線服務:
Azure物聯網中心
詳細信息:
開發環境(Window 10,Code)
關于設置開發環境的信息可以在官方文檔中(入門指南)中找到。
我參考了文檔中的WINdows和Visual Studio Code環境部分。
點擊下方鏈接查詢相關文檔資料
1.Raspberry Pi Pico SDK
-Raspberry Pi Pico SDK: Raspberry Pi Pico SDK
2.RPI?Pico Getting Started Guide
-https://datasheets.raspberrypi.com/pico/getting-started-with-pico.pdf
本指南詳細描述了開發環境配置,因此你可以根據自己的開發環境來進行配置。
需要做的第一件事是安裝和使用Visual Studio 2019的構建工具。如果你通過VS命令提示符運行VS Code,你可以使用相關的工具。
一開始,我試圖不檢查這部分,但是它總是失敗,所以我再次閱讀指南并應用內容。
必須首先安裝Visual Studio構建工具!
使用開發人員命令提示符運行VS代碼
使用Vsual Studio的構建環境,通過VS 2019的開發人員命令提示符運行VS Code,如下所示:
??打開Visual Studio Code,并設置所有正確的環境變量,以便正確配置工具鏈。
VS代碼設置
為了在VS Code中構建,CMake和Pico SDK路徑設置如下。
"cmake.cmakePath": "C:Program FilesCMakebincmake.exe",
"cmake.configureSettings": {
??????"PICO_SDK_PATH": "D:_RaspberryPi_Picopico-sdk"
},
Github庫
該代碼使用了WIZnet提供的RP2040-HAT-AZURE-C項目。
使用git命令將項目克隆到本地。
GitHub - Wiznet/RP2040-HAT-AZURE-C: Azure IoT SDK Example for RP2040
git clone https://github.com/Wiznet/RP2040-HAT-AZURE-C
通過開發人員命令提示符VS代碼,然后通過打開文件夾菜單打開項目目錄。
集中應用設置:
有了LoT Central試驗計劃(7天),您可以創建和使用應用程序,而無需訂閱Azure。7天后需要重新訂閱Azure。
更多信息,請參考MS Azure指南。
- [MS Guide] Create an IoT Central application
-Create an IoT Central application | Microsoft Docs
- IoT Central home
-主頁 | Azure IoT Central
原始鏈接:
- How to connect to Azure IoT Central using W5100S-EVB-Pico - Hackster.io
- [W5100S-EVB-Pico] X.509 ???? ???? Azure IoT Central? ????
文檔:
代碼:
RP2040-HAT-AZURE-C?-GitHub - Wiznet/RP2040-HAT-AZURE-C: Azure IoT SDK Example for RP2040
歡迎討論!
總結
以上是生活随笔為你收集整理的如何使用W5100S-EVB-Pico连接Azure物联网中心的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 一级圆柱齿轮减速机装配图三维 CAD图纸
- 下一篇: 一文详解 JDK1.8 的 Lambda